The City of Steinbach is once again offering local residents the option of bringing compostable items to one of two community compost depots to be held every Saturday from May 13 until October 21, 2017.

The depots will be located at Woodlawn School (411 Henry Street) and Stonybrook Middle School by the track (77 Lumber Avenue), and will be available every Saturday from 9am to 3pm during the scheduled dates.

Residents are encouraged to use compostable yard waste bags, as well, the City is offering the following composting guidelines:

What to compost:

  • vegetables & fruit (fresh, cooked, canned)
  • coffee grounds / filters
  • tea leaves / bags
  • egg shells
  • bread
  • plain rice / plain pasta
  • garden waste
  • weeds without seeds
  • grass clippings
  • leaves

Do not compost:

  • meat / fish / bones
  • eggs / dairy products
  • oily foods / sauces
  • pet waste
  • diseased plants
  • metals
  • synthetic materials
  • plastic / petroleum products

The material collected at the depots is composted and screened at the Landfill and used in the City’s parks and gardens. When available, the public can pick up finished compost from the Steinbach Landfill at no charge.
